The Purple Glow Effect.
an excerpt from ‘Elemental Mind: Human Consciousness and the New Physics’ by Nick Herbert: Experiments to Detect Inner Experience - The “Purple Glow Effect”Suppose there is a small central portion of the brain that is responsible for consciousness while the rest of the brain is a brain’s central authority. (As evidence for the notion that consciousness is a localized brain function, we observe that large portions of the cortext and other segments of the central nervous system can be removed without loss of consciousness.) Suppose moreover that whenever a person is awake (not asleep, comatose, or “absentminded”) this crucial portion of the brain emits a distincitive p u r p l e g l o w . Unlike electricaly signals, which are produced at all times, this glow occurs only in association with conscious experience. Suppose that furthers research shows that although the purple glow is physically identical to ordinary light, its production cannot be explained by normal electromagnetic mechnisms. In order to fit the purple glow phenomenon into physics, scientists must invoke a previously unsuspected new force linking light and the inner life, a link that mystics have metaphorically celebrated for centuries. (It goes without saying that evidence for purple glow or any other special physical manifestation of awareness is nil.)Alternatively, instead of ordinary light, conscious entities might signal their presence by emitting new kinds of elementary particles (cogitons?). Cogitons might be detectable by physical means or they might interact only with other conscious beings, leading to a new class of particle detector. Thus the human mind would act as a sort of psychic Geiger counter.The “purple glow,” “cogiton,” or similar phenomena would represent a simple and direct answer to the behaviorist challened. These phenomena are (or would be, if they existed) types of physical behavior uniquely associated with consciousness and with no other physical process. The presence of such phenomena would open consciousness (human and otherwise) to examination via the same objective methods that have been so successful in the physical sciences. Purple-glow physicists might even detect the purple glow in inanimate systems and draw the conclusion (scientifically based, not mere prejudice) that stars, rocks, and atoms are conscious.
